💾 Archived View for gemini.ctrl-c.club › ~phoebos › logs › kisslinux-2022-03-13.txt captured on 2024-05-26 at 16:09:41.
⬅️ Previous capture (2022-04-28)
-=-=-=-=-=-=-
[2022-03-13T00:43:50Z] <sad_plan> nevermind [2022-03-13T01:14:38Z] <midfavila> sad_plan I use everything under core/official and mbase [2022-03-13T01:41:24Z] <sad_plan> ok, cool [2022-03-13T03:19:20Z] <testuser[m]> Hi [2022-03-13T03:19:55Z] <sad_plan> hi [2022-03-13T12:56:55Z] <illiliti> https://github.com/kiss-community/repo/pull/48 [2022-03-13T13:14:46Z] <illiliti> in ideal world, we should be able to get rid of glib [2022-03-13T13:14:56Z] <illiliti> but that's not possible sadly :( [2022-03-13T13:15:07Z] <illiliti> this garbage hardcoded everywhere [2022-03-13T13:16:10Z] <testuser[m]> What's so bad about it [2022-03-13T13:16:13Z] <testuser[m]> What does it even do [2022-03-13T13:16:21Z] <testuser[m]> I've only seen it used for some DS [2022-03-13T13:18:06Z] <illiliti> suckless has some good notes about it [2022-03-13T13:19:00Z] <illiliti> basically, it tries to bring java into c [2022-03-13T13:19:16Z] <illiliti> absolute madness [2022-03-13T13:19:44Z] <testuser[m]> The only point on the suckless page is that it aborts on OOM which is indeed bad for a library but tbh it's acceptable [2022-03-13T13:21:00Z] <illiliti> no, it's not acceptable [2022-03-13T13:21:07Z] <illiliti> it is highly abused by soydevs who don't understand idiomatic c [2022-03-13T13:22:26Z] <testuser[m]> What do u do if malloc fails [2022-03-13T13:22:47Z] <testuser[m]> In my libs i don't abort but in programs i do [2022-03-13T13:22:53Z] <testuser[m]> in libs u return failure [2022-03-13T13:25:45Z] <illiliti> depends [2022-03-13T14:53:49Z] <dilyn> testuser[m]: yes, tab crashing is a big problem for me and always has been on chromium :v [2022-03-13T16:07:42Z] <anonym> Hi [2022-03-13T16:07:55Z] <anonym> testuser[m]: have you tried nouveau? [2022-03-13T16:08:08Z] <illiliti> dilyn: at least tab crashing is a good indicator that website is bloated af [2022-03-13T16:08:28Z] <dilyn> happens a lot on google's websites [2022-03-13T16:08:38Z] <dilyn> I frequently experience tab crashes during work meetings:) [2022-03-13T16:10:08Z] <illiliti> google websites are full of spyware javascript. no wonder why they crash xd [2022-03-13T16:10:29Z] <testuser[m]> What reply do u give [2022-03-13T16:10:30Z] <testuser[m]> anonym: no [2022-03-13T16:11:32Z] <illiliti> ? [2022-03-13T16:14:45Z] <testuser[m]> illiliti: i was asking dilyn [2022-03-13T16:15:04Z] <illiliti> ok [2022-03-13T16:15:17Z] <dilyn> "This meeting's so nice I joined it twice" [2022-03-13T16:15:39Z] <dilyn> because for about two minutes there's an overlap between my frozen, crashed instance and the new and improved instance :v [2022-03-13T16:16:42Z] <testuser[m]> Why don't u just use ff [2022-03-13T16:17:09Z] <dilyn> Because building rust is a slog I don't appreciate [2022-03-13T16:17:15Z] <dilyn> building chromium is faster than building rust+firefox [2022-03-13T16:17:34Z] <testuser[m]> but building rust once in 3 months and building ff is faster [2022-03-13T16:17:38Z] <testuser[m]> 20 mins vs 6 hrs [2022-03-13T16:18:22Z] <dilyn> i mean that's also true [2022-03-13T16:18:23Z] <dilyn> but [2022-03-13T16:18:27Z] <dilyn> https://github.com/kiss-community/repo/blob/master/extra/firefox/depends [2022-03-13T16:18:30Z] <dilyn> this is the other reason :v [2022-03-13T16:18:37Z] <dilyn> I use firefox in my Ubuntu VM for work at least... xD [2022-03-13T16:18:56Z] <testuser[m]> Aren't the deps the same almost? [2022-03-13T16:19:01Z] <dilyn> gtk [2022-03-13T16:19:03Z] <testuser[m]> Oh ig u removed gtk from chromium [2022-03-13T16:19:06Z] <testuser[m]> yea [2022-03-13T16:19:07Z] <dilyn> yah [2022-03-13T16:19:17Z] <dilyn> aura needs to get better. I want my dialog boxes back [2022-03-13T16:19:38Z] <testuser[m]> ur so dedicated [2022-03-13T16:19:43Z] <dilyn> finding alternative ways of uploading files is a challenge. Some websites are smart enough to allow you to do it from file:// [2022-03-13T16:20:02Z] <dilyn> I'm just willing to forgo minor convenience for principles :c [2022-03-13T16:21:26Z] <testuser[m]> Btw do u manually check outdated packages for community repo [2022-03-13T16:21:35Z] <dilyn> about once a month [2022-03-13T16:21:53Z] <testuser[m]> How [2022-03-13T16:22:00Z] <testuser[m]> There's hundreds of them [2022-03-13T16:22:10Z] <dilyn> wdym? [2022-03-13T16:22:15Z] <dilyn> kiss out git/community [2022-03-13T16:23:06Z] <testuser[m]> Yea i was asking if u did it by hand [2022-03-13T16:23:10Z] <testuser[m]> Lol [2022-03-13T16:23:15Z] <dilyn> oic [2022-03-13T16:23:20Z] <testuser[m]> Instead of the outdated script [2022-03-13T16:23:21Z] <dilyn> lol yeah no fuck that [2022-03-13T16:29:39Z] <testuser[m]> illiliti: what was the problem with firefox ipv6 again? [2022-03-13T16:50:32Z] <illiliti> it doesn't work at all [2022-03-13T16:50:54Z] <illiliti> even direct access by ip address [2022-03-13T17:04:16Z] <testuser[m]> illiliti: what does it say [2022-03-13T17:05:01Z] <testuser[m]> exactly [2022-03-13T17:06:51Z] <illiliti> i don't remember [2022-03-13T17:06:55Z] <illiliti> i'm not at home atm [2022-03-13T17:28:31Z] <illiliti> phoebos: are you here? can you help? [2022-03-13T18:47:48Z] <phoebos> let me test again [2022-03-13T18:53:29Z] <phoebos> testuser[m]: just says "Unable to connect" [2022-03-13T18:54:25Z] <phoebos> can't see anything in the dev tools [2022-03-13T18:58:13Z] <phoebos> https://tmp.bvnf.space/out.png [2022-03-13T18:58:28Z] <phoebos> works as expected on glibc [2022-03-13T18:59:54Z] <illiliti> thanks for the help [2022-03-13T19:00:05Z] <phoebos> not much help lol [2022-03-13T19:57:33Z] <aosync> hello guys [2022-03-13T19:57:38Z] <aosync> phoebos: are you auscyberman ? [2022-03-13T19:58:14Z] <aosync> has dylan given any updates on the direction ? [2022-03-13T20:01:25Z] <phoebos> aosync: on shithub i'm aabacchus [2022-03-13T20:02:07Z] <aosync> by shithub, you mean github right? not actual shithub [2022-03-13T20:02:13Z] <phoebos> yes [2022-03-13T20:02:59Z] <aosync> I know someone that used to be active on the unixporn community that was a fan of phoebe bridgers [2022-03-13T20:37:35Z] <rohan> hey guys [2022-03-13T20:37:41Z] <rohan> whats new? [2022-03-13T20:53:37Z] <ax> good evening all [2022-03-13T20:53:50Z] <ax> -> Building: explicit: terminus-font, implicit: bdftopcf [2022-03-13T20:53:52Z] <ax> ERROR 'bdftopcf' not found [2022-03-13T20:54:05Z] <ax> kisscommunity repo [2022-03-13T20:55:57Z] <rohan> maybe get purged [2022-03-13T20:59:11Z] <rohan> what i see bdftopcf have xorg dependencies [2022-03-13T21:00:06Z] <rohan> thats why not more in community [2022-03-13T21:01:15Z] <ax> i know but it in community repo [2022-03-13T21:01:31Z] <ax> for this I have reported [2022-03-13T21:02:53Z] <ax> it should probably only be in the kiss-xorg repo [2022-03-13T21:04:08Z] <phoebos> nice find ax, will have to drop terminus-font from community probably [2022-03-13T21:05:44Z] <ax> phoebos: imagine, I was annoyed to open a pull request for this type of report ... I preferred to do it directly here [2022-03-13T21:06:13Z] <phoebos> dilyn: [2022-03-13T21:14:58Z] <phoebos> actually it looks like bdftopcf is only required for X11 fonts [2022-03-13T21:22:48Z] <phoebos> ax: you could send this patch to aarng (the maintainer of terminus-font): https://tmp.bvnf.space/0001-terminus-font-remove-dep-on-bdftopcf.patch [2022-03-13T21:23:47Z] <phoebos> kiss main terminus-font [2022-03-13T22:06:00Z] <phoebos> will kiss-community restart maintaining kiss itself? lot of changes to kiss from what happened with the last fork